You are exactly right! The "strictly stock" series was started in 1949 one year after NASCAR was formed. As implied, everything was to be strictly stock. The cars were usually driven to the race track and driven home. (If they were in any condition to drive. )
This series was immensley popular in the 50's. So much so that it overshadowed the original "modified series".
It eventually morphed into the "grand national" series in the 60's, "Winston Cup" in the 70's, 80's and 90's. Then "Nextel Cup"and "Sprint Cup" of today.
